Abstract:
BACKGROUND: The Italian National Institute of Health (Istituto Superiore di Sanità) funded a 30-month project (July 2021-January 2024) to conduct a twin study of the relationships between Positive Mental Health (PMH) and cellular longevity. Only a few previous studies have focused on the biomarkers of aging in relation to psychological well-being, and none of them exploited the potential of the twin design.
METHODS: In this project, following the standard procedures of the Italian Twin Registry (ITR), we aim to recruit 200 adult twin pairs enrolled in the ITR. They are requested to complete a self-report questionnaire battery on PMH and to undergo a blood withdrawal for the assessment of aging biomarkers, i.e., telomere length and mitochondrial DNA functionality. The association between psychological and aging biomarker measures will be assessed, controlling for genetic and familial confounding effects using the twin study design.
CONCLUSIONS: Biomarker assays are underway. Once data are available for the total study sample, statistical analyses will be performed. The project\'s results may shed light on new mechanisms underlying the mind-body connection and may prove helpful to promote psychological well-being in conjunction with biological functioning.
摘要:
背景:意大利国家卫生研究所(IstitutoSuperiordiSanità)资助了一个为期30个月的项目(2021年7月至2024年1月),对积极心理健康(PMH)与细胞寿命之间的关系进行了双重研究。以前只有少数研究集中在与心理健康相关的衰老生物标志物上,他们都没有利用孪生设计的潜力。
方法:在这个项目中,遵循意大利双胞胎登记处(ITR)的标准程序,我们的目标是招募200对加入ITR的成年双胞胎。他们被要求完成一份关于PMH的自我报告问卷,并接受抽血以评估衰老的生物标志物,即,端粒长度和线粒体DNA功能。将评估心理和衰老生物标志物之间的关联,使用双胞胎研究设计控制遗传和家族混杂效应。
结论:生物标志物测定正在进行中。一旦总研究样本的数据可用,将进行统计分析。该项目的结果可能会阐明身心联系的新机制,并可能有助于促进心理健康与生物功能的结合。
